Lisa Perrotti-Brown: Deep garnet-purple colored, the 2025 Vray Croix de Gay bursts with bold notes of stewed black plums and black cherry preserves, followed by hints of Indian spices, candied violets, and black licorice. The medium-bodied palate delivers stewed black fruit layers with a light chewiness to the texture and well-knit acidity, finishing long and spicy. The blend is 82% Merlot and 18% Cabernet Franc. It has a pH of 3.8 and the alcohol is 13.6%. It is aging for 18 months in oak barriques, 80% new."

Jeb Dunnuck: A solid, supple Pomerol, the 2025 Château La Croix De Gay is based on 86.5% Merlot and 13.5% Cabernet Franc that's being raised in 35% new barrels. It offers ripe black cherries, red plums, spicy herbs, and dried flowers on the nose. Medium to full-bodied on the palate, it's round and textured, with soft tannins, a layered, balanced mouthfeel, and outstanding length. It checks in at 13.67% alcohol with a pH of 3.76."
